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Warnham to Folkestone Central start from £27.00 one way, or £27.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Warnham to Folkestone Central are available for £27.90 one way, or £36.60 return

Facilities and Amenities at Warnham Station

Warnham station is all about simplicity and functionality. There is no ticket office, but don't worry, you can still purchase your tickets from the available ticket machines which are also equipped to provide t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. The machines are accessible, although you might want to double-check their locations via the station map.

If you’re a tech-savvy traveler, note that Warnham station is not yet equipped with public Wi-Fi, nor does it have waiting lounges or refreshment facilities, so planning ahead is advised. But if assistance is needed, help points are strategically placed on platforms, offering assistance at any hour.

Accessibility at Warnham Station

Accessibility is a key focus, with step-free access available to each platform via separate entrances. It’s important to mention that access to platform 1 requires a trek up a steep ramp. Though staff help isn't available at the station, most trains have onboard staff to assist passengers with mobility requirements. Ensuring a smooth journey for everyone is a priority at Warnham, so do plan accordingly if extra assistance is required.

Facilities at Folkestone Central

Stepping into Folkestone Central, you're greeted by a welcoming environment that caters to all your travel necessities. For those purchasing or collecting tickets, the station boasts a ticket office open from Monday to Saturday, 6:00 to 19:00, and on Sundays from 8:10 to 17:40. Ticket machines are available for added convenience, with the capability to collect pre-booked tickets. Accessibility is a priority here, with an induction loop and accessible ticket machines located in the booking hall.

For individuals requiring assistance, there are customer help points and detailed staff support available. Travel information features through comprehensive departure screens and announcements, ensuring you are always updated with the latest schedule information. While luggage storage isn't available, you can rest easy knowing CCTV is in operation for enhanced security.

Passengers with mobility needs can navigate the station effortlessly thanks to step-free access across all platforms. Facilities such as accessible toilets, ramps for train access, and wheelchairs ensure a barrier-free environment. The station also offers four accessible parking spaces, although accessible car park equipment is not installed. Heated waiting rooms and adequate seating areas make waiting for your train a comfortable experience.
